Recognizing Low-VOC Paints



When you select low-VOC paints, you're opting for an item that sends out less volatile organic compounds, which can be harmful to both your health and wellness and the atmosphere.



VOCs are chemicals found in numerous paint products that can vaporize into the air and add to indoor air pollution. By choosing how to paint a mobile home exterior -VOC choices, you're lowering the number of these discharges, making your space more secure.

This means that when you paint your home with low-VOC items, you're not simply deciding for aesthetics; you're additionally taking an action towards a healthier interior setting.

These paints come in a range of finishes and shades, so you won't need to jeopardize on design. They're suitable for both interior and exterior jobs, offering longevity and insurance coverage like their standard counterparts.

And also, many suppliers are currently concentrating on developing low-VOC formulations without giving up performance. Understanding low-VOC paints equips you to make informed selections for your home and wellness while adding to environmental conservation.

Benefits of Low-VOC Options



Why pick low-VOC alternatives for your painting projects? First of all, they're much better for your wellness. Low-VOC paints give off fewer unstable natural compounds, which means you decrease your exposure to hazardous chemicals. This is specifically essential if you're repainting inside or have children and animals at home.

You'll likewise value the ecological advantages. These paints contribute much less to air contamination, making them a greener choice. By opting for low-VOC choices, you're sustaining sustainable practices and aiding to create a healthier world.

An additional perk is the enhanced indoor air quality. Low-VOC paints aid keep fresher air in your house, which can result in an extra comfy living area.

And also, lots of low-VOC paints are just as long lasting and lasting as conventional choices, so you won't compromise top quality for safety.

Lastly, you'll discover a variety of colors and finishes offered in low-VOC solutions, so you can still attain the appearance you desire without endangering on your health or the atmosphere.

Choosing low-VOC paints is a clever, accountable decision for your painting jobs.

Prospective Disadvantages to Think About



While low-VOC paints provide countless advantages, there are some potential disadvantages to bear in mind. One considerable problem is their efficiency contrasted to typical paints. Low-VOC options might not constantly offer the exact same degree of sturdiness and insurance coverage, which can cause more frequent touch-ups or a demand for added coats. Another issue is the drying time. Low-VOC paints typically take longer to dry than their high-VOC equivalents, which can prolong your task timeline. If you get on a tight routine, this might be a disadvantage to think about.

You need to additionally know that low-VOC paints can sometimes have a different surface or structure. If you're aiming for a particular aesthetic, make certain to check examples to guarantee the result satisfies your expectations.

Lastly, while low-VOC paints are typically safer, they can still send out some fumes. Correct air flow is necessary throughout and after application, so be prepared to air out your area successfully.
